
Reem bint Ibrahim Al Hashemi
Reem bint Ibrahim Al Hashemi is the Minister of State for International Cooperation in the United Arab Emirates. She is known for her active role in promoting the UAE's international relations and development initiatives. In the recent news, she awarded Antonis Alexandridis the Order of Independence, First Class, recognizing his significant contributions to enhancing UAE-Greece relations during his ambassadorship.
